Annie Jane Cotten, 26, who wore pasties on her bare breasts and a black sarong rolled up around her waist, said many people have the attitude that roads are made for cars only.
“But there are alternative modes of transportation out there,” she said, “and bikes happen to be one of the best.”
Saturday’s ride started at Washington Square Park at Royal Street and Elysian Fields Avenue. It traveled nine blocks down Royal before the cyclists headed back to the park via Bourbon Street, escorted by New Orleans Police Department vehicles and a car stereo blaring songs including the rock band Blink 182’s “All the Small Things.”
Perhaps because the scene unfolded so close to Bourbon’s strip clubs, many observers quickly overcame their initial shock and shouted, “Whoo!” as the riders passed. Some wolf whistled. Others flipped on camcorders and digital cameras to capture the scene.
